It was originally believed that cars post September would get it, but it's in fact not coming until 2011, that's not MY2011, but calendar year 2011.

September 2010 production cars will get Bluetooth streaming and cover art support. It MAY be the case that cars with the September changes will be able to then software update to the new iPod interface when BMW releases it. Just MAY BE.

How is the new interface?

I am waiting for a new car with ipod interface, but the one I saw was a bit disapointing. It uses the audio output for headphones for the audio signal, and this way it's impossible to achieve good audio quality.
The new system (September production cars onwards) will be using the standard Apple USB cable for audio and data transmission so it may get better audio quality. For those that may wonder, the current setup uses a Y cable that plug into the iPod/iPhone dock connector, and on the other end to USB and aux into the BMW. The new system will simply use a standard USB cable to go from iPod dock connector to BMW USB.

Don't expect that too happen anytime soon. From the looks of it, BMW isn't going to be investing anything into the current platform of the 35d engine as in the application of the 335d and X5 xDrive35d in the US market. The engine has been upgraded in the rest of the world to 300 hp and slightly uprated torque for the X5, X6, 7er, 5GT, and a few other models, while the US stayed with the older engine. It also was the only X5 model throughout the world to remain with the 6 speed auto, instead of the ZF 8 Speed. I'm guessing BMW has put out the older engine, and any new drivetrain updates will be in combination with the new engine. They haven't brought over the engine for the US market possibly because diesel sales don't warrant certification of yet another engine.

They may have plans for a newer engine to launch with the F30 3er (either a diesel 4 or 6) so they don't want to certify an engine in the interim.
